Just like the rest of the school, Elementary students start with choice time. Students can write, read, draw, or participate in outdoor games.
In Elementary at The Common School we take project based, experiential learning to a new level. This year in E2, students are using our new rain garden to study water quality alongside an exploration of the Dakota Access Pipeline and the controversy surrounding it.
